INSTRUMENTATION OF MIDP APPLICATIONS FOR ONE-DEVICE TESTING
First Claim
Patent Images
1. A method for testing a MIDlet application with a test application, the method comprising:
- a) modifying the MIDlet application to form a modified MIDlet application, the modified MIDlet application allowing the test application to access one or more functions, variables, or classes from the MIDlet application;
b) bundling the MIDlet application with the test application to form a testable MIDlet application;
c) executing the testable MIDlet application on a MIDlet capable device or a MIDlet-capable device emulator; and
d) collecting test results from step c),wherein step c) preformed without a user physically interacting with the MIDlet capable device.
1 Assignment
0 Petitions
Accused Products
Abstract
A method for testing a MIDlet application with a test application includes a step of modifying the MIDlet application to form a modified MIDlet application which allows the test application to access one or more functions, variables, or classes from the MIDlet application. The MIDlet application is then bundled with the test application to form a testable MIDlet application. The testable MIDlet application is executed on a MIDlet capable device or a MIDlet-capable device emulator and test results are collected. A system executing the method is also provided.
5 Citations
20 Claims
-
1. A method for testing a MIDlet application with a test application, the method comprising:
-
a) modifying the MIDlet application to form a modified MIDlet application, the modified MIDlet application allowing the test application to access one or more functions, variables, or classes from the MIDlet application; b) bundling the MIDlet application with the test application to form a testable MIDlet application; c) executing the testable MIDlet application on a MIDlet capable device or a MIDlet-capable device emulator; and d) collecting test results from step c), wherein step c) preformed without a user physically interacting with the MIDlet capable device.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A method for testing a MIDlet application with a test application, the method comprising:
-
a) modifying the MIDlet application to form a modified MIDlet application, the modified MIDlet application allowing the test application to access one or more functions, variables, or classes from the MIDlet application; b) bundling the MIDlet application with the test application to form a testable MIDlet application; c) executing the testable MIDlet application on a MIDlet capable device or a MIDlet-capable device emulator; and d) collecting test results from step c), wherein steps a)-d) are preformed automatically without user intervention. - View Dependent Claims (12, 13, 14, 15)
-
-
16. A system for testing a MIDlet application with a test application, the system including a microprocessor operable to execute the following steps:
-
a) modifying the MIDlet application to form a modified MIDlet application, the modified MIDlet application allowing the test application to access one or more functions, variables, or classes from the MIDlet application; b) bundling the MIDlet application with the test application to form a testable MIDlet application; c) executing the testable MIDlet application on a MIDlet capable device or a MIDlet-capable device emulator; and d) collecting test results from step c). - View Dependent Claims (17, 18, 19, 20)
-
Specification